Flyers D Coburn out for Game Four
May 15, 2008 - 6:53 PM PHILADELPHIA (Ticker) -- Philadelphia Flyers defenseman Braydon Coburn will miss Game Four of the Eastern Conference finals against the Pittsburgh Penguins, the team announced Thursday.The team's No. 2 defenseman, Coburn left Sunday's setback at Pittsburgh just 1:51 into the first period after being on the receiving end of a puck to the face.
He also missed Tuesday's defeat, as his left eye was still swollen shut.
Coburn skated with the team on Wednesday but is still not ready to return to game action.
"We're not going to put anybody back in the lineup if we don't feel they're ready to play, and clearly that's the case right now," Flyers coach John Stevens said. "He's a young kid that wants to play. He's really kind of distraught right now that he's not able to play.
"We're hopeful we'll win this game today, and we have a couple of days before we play again, and hopefully we can get him back."
Flyers rookie defenseman Ryan Parent will play again in Game Four after making his return to the lineup on Tuesday. Parent was a healthy scratch for Philadelphia's previous 13 contests.
